Přidání proměnných na kartu
Proměnné uchovávají data pro opětovné použití. Tato data mohou být různého typu, například kolekce, text nebo číslo. Proměnné mají jedinečné názvy, pomocí kterých na ně odkazujete ve Power Fxvzorcích. Vložte, upravte a odeberte je v návrháři karet.
Hodnota proměnné může být dočasná a obnovovat se pro každou relaci karty, nebo trvalá, kdy je sdílena ve všech relacích pro konkrétní instanci karty. Dočasné proměnné se liší pro každou relaci karty, dokonce i pro jednoho uživatele, což znamená, že pokud vám byla zaslána stejná instance karty v chatu a kanálu, dočasná proměnná se může v těchto dvou relacích lišit.
Jako příklad jste vytvořili kartu, která počítá, kolikrát uživatel během relace stiskne tlačítko. Vytvořili byste dočasnou číselnou proměnnou pro uložení počtu stisknutí tlačítka v aktuální instanci karty. Pokud byste také chtěli zachytit jméno posledního uživatele, který stiskl tlačítko pro instanci karty, uložili byste jej v trvalé textové proměnné. Pokud byste chtěli dále uložit data mezi instancemi karet, použili byste datové připojení.
Proměnné lze také přizpůsobit, což znamená, že hodnotu nastavuje odesílatel, ať už je to na stránce Přehrání před odesláním jako odkaz, nebo v Power Automate jako součást akce Vytvoření instance karty.
Předpoklady
- Účet Power Apps
- Karta
Vytvoření proměnné
Přihlaste se ke službě Power Apps. Vyberte Karty a poté vyberte kartu. Pokud karta Karty není viditelná, vyberte Více a připněte kartu Karty.
V levém podokně návrháře karet vyberte Proměnné.
Vyberte + Nová proměnná.
V okně Nová proměnná nastavte následující hodnoty.
- Název: Název vaší proměnné (povinné).
- Typ: Typ proměnné (povinné).
- Výchozí hodnota: Výchozí hodnota proměnné.
- Trvalost: Zda je proměnná dočasná (resetuje se při každém otevření karty) nebo trvalá.
- Vlastní nastavení: Zda je proměnná přizpůsobitelná odesílatelem, aby fungovala jako vstupní proměnná.
Název nebo typ proměnné nelze změnit nebo odstranit. Pokud je potřebujete změnit, vytvořte novou proměnnou.
Můžete také přizpůsobit možnosti odesílatele a v sekci Další informace o proměnné také Název a Popis proměnné. Tyto informace mohou být užitečné pro testování a ladění a použití vaší proměnné s toky Power Automate.
Vyberte Uložit.
Použití výchozí hodnoty pro tabulky a záznamy
Výchozí hodnota se používá k nastavení struktury proměnných kolekce a záznamu. Existují dva způsoby, jak nastavit výchozí hodnotu proměnné záznamu nebo tabulky:
- Používání editoru sloupců
- Používání Power Fx / JSON
Pomocí přepínače napravo můžete přepínat mezi používáním editoru sloupců nebo Power Fx / JSON.
Použití výrazu Power Fx je užitečné, když chcete, aby proměnná uchovávala data ze zdroje dat, například z Dataverse. Pokud například chcete záznam, který obsahuje konkrétní řádek z tabulky Obchodní vztah, můžete nastavit výchozí hodnotu na First(Account)
.
Proměnné mají silné typování, takže nastavení výchozí hodnoty uzamkne proměnnou do těchto typů.
Úprava a odstranění proměnných
Chcete-li upravit nebo odstranit proměnnou, vyberte tři tečky (...) napravo od proměnné a poté vyberte Upravit nebo Odstranit.
Použití proměnných v kartách
Existují různé způsoby, jak používat proměnné v kartách. Další informace o práci s proměnnými v Power Apps.
Běžné použití proměnných je ve výrazech Power Fx. Odkazujte na proměnnou názvem ve vašem vzorci. Pro příklad přejděte do jednoduchého kurzu vytvoření karty. Vaše proměnné lze uplatnit také v řádku vzorců.
Aktualizace hodnoty proměnné
Proměnné lze aktualizovat pomocí funkce Set s výjimkou proměnných tabulky, které se přidávají pomocí funkce Collect.
Váš názor
https://aka.ms/ContentUserFeedback.
Připravujeme: V průběhu roku 2024 budeme postupně vyřazovat problémy z GitHub coby mechanismus zpětné vazby pro obsah a nahrazovat ho novým systémem zpětné vazby. Další informace naleznete v tématu:Odeslat a zobrazit názory pro